Engine, Battery, and Performance Specs:
Battery & Charging Specifications
The battery system centers on a 90.1 kWh pack delivering up to 550 km or about 342 miles of WLTP range. Fast charging stands out, adding roughly 500 km or 310 miles in about ten minutes through high output DC stations. Energy efficiency remains strong for a vehicle weighing around 2,580 kg or 5,688 lb.
- Battery capacity 90.1 kWh
- WLTP range 550 km or 342 miles
- Ultra fast DC charging capability
Electric Motor Specifications
Dual electric motors deliver a combined 544 hp or about 400 kW. Torque reaches 660 Nm or 487 lb ft, feeding all four wheels through an AWD layout. Power delivery stays smooth and immediate, supporting confident driving in wet or snowy conditions.
- Dual motor AWD configuration
- Power output 544 hp or 400 kW
- Torque 660 Nm or 487 lb ft
Performance Specifications
Acceleration reaches 100 kmh or 62 mph in 4.5 seconds, quick for a large family SUV. Top speed caps at 180 kmh or 112 mph, tuned for stability rather than autobahn chasing.
- 0 to 100 kmh in 4.5 seconds
- Top speed 180 kmh or 112 mph
For daily use, the balance favors quiet cruising, predictable grip, and relaxed long distance travel.
Exterior and Interior Features
Exterior Design
The exterior emphasizes airflow management through a smooth nose and long roofline. A drag coefficient of 0.218 supports highway efficiency. LED lighting spans front and rear, while flush door handles reduce turbulence. Wheel sizes reach 20 or 21 inches, blending visual presence with aerodynamic inserts.
Interior & Technology
Inside, the cabin adopts a six seat 2 plus 2 plus 2 layout. Dual 15.7 inch displays run high resolution graphics powered by a fast processor. Materials include soft leather, sustainable fabrics, and warm metallic accents. A head up display replaces a traditional gauge cluster, keeping focus forward.
The interior works like a lounge on wheels, prioritizing comfort during long drives and school runs alike.

Range and Real World Usability
Range figures cluster tightly, yet usable distance tells a deeper story. The Li Auto i8 emphasizes efficiency through aerodynamics, helping its 342 mile figure feel achievable on highways. Huawei Aito M9 stretches further on paper but carries more mass. NIO ES8 and XPeng G9 balance strong range with performance tuning. Tesla Model X favors speed, often trading steady cruising efficiency for outright thrust.
Charging Time and Daily Convenience
Charging behavior separates practical ownership from specs talk. Ultra fast DC capability allows the Li Auto i8 to add hundreds of miles in minutes, fitting busy family schedules. XPeng G9 follows closely with high voltage architecture. Tesla relies on Supercharger density rather than peak speed. NIO leans on battery swapping, while Huawei focuses on fast but less widely supported charging networks.
Price Positioning and Value Logic
Price strategy defines audience reach. With a starting point far below Tesla Model X and NIO ES8, the Li Auto i8 delivers premium space without premium pricing. XPeng G9 sits mid pack, pairing strong performance with moderate cost. Huawei Aito M9 leans upscale through technology density. Value seekers prioritize usable range and charging speed over brand prestige alone.
